This patch fixes a problem that when a computer with HPA on it's hard
drive comes out of sleep mode it needs the disks capacity reinitialized.

diff -Naur linux-2.6.18-rc4-old/include/linux/ide.h
linux-2.6.18-rc4/include/linux/ide.h
--- linux-2.6.18-rc4-old/include/linux/ide.h 2006-08-19
03:49:03.000000000 -0400
+++ linux-2.6.18-rc4/include/linux/ide.h 2006-08-20
19:13:10.000000000 -0400
@@ -1201,6 +1201,17 @@
void ide_register_subdriver(ide_drive_t *, ide_driver_t *);
void ide_unregister_subdriver(ide_drive_t *, ide_driver_t *);
+/* Bits 10 of command_set_1 and cfs_enable_1 must be equal,
+ * so on non-buggy drives we need test only one.
+ * However, we should also check whether these fields are valid.
+*/
+static inline int idedisk_supports_hpa(const struct hd_driveid *id)
+{
+ return (id->command_set_1 & 0x0400) && (id->cfs_enable_1 & 0x0400);
+}
+
+extern void init_idedisk_capacity (ide_drive_t *drive);
+
#define ON_BOARD 1
#define NEVER_BOARD 0
diff -Naur linux-2.6.18-rc4-old/drivers/ide/ide-disk.c
linux-2.6.18-rc4/drivers/ide/ide-disk.c
--- linux-2.6.18-rc4-old/drivers/ide/ide-disk.c 2006-08-19
03:49:03.000000000 -0400
+++ linux-2.6.18-rc4/drivers/ide/ide-disk.c 2006-08-20
19:13:56.000000000 -0400
@@ -464,16 +464,6 @@
}
/*
- * Bits 10 of command_set_1 and cfs_enable_1 must be equal,
- * so on non-buggy drives we need test only one.
- * However, we should also check whether these fields are valid.
- */
-static inline int idedisk_supports_hpa(const struct hd_driveid *id)
-{
- return (id->command_set_1 & 0x0400) && (id->cfs_enable_1 & 0x0400);
-}
-
-/*
* The same here.
*/
static inline int idedisk_supports_lba48(const struct hd_driveid *id)
@@ -528,7 +518,7 @@
* in above order (i.e., if value of higher priority is available,
* reset will be ignored).
*/
-static void init_idedisk_capacity (ide_drive_t *drive)
+void init_idedisk_capacity (ide_drive_t *drive)
{
struct hd_driveid *id = drive->id;
/*
@@ -555,6 +545,8 @@
}
}
+EXPORT_SYMBOL(init_idedisk_capacity);
+
static sector_t idedisk_capacity (ide_drive_t *drive)
{
return drive->capacity64 - drive->sect0;
diff -Naur linux-2.6.18-rc4-old/drivers/ide/ide.c
linux-2.6.18-rc4/drivers/ide/ide.c
--- linux-2.6.18-rc4-old/drivers/ide/ide.c 2006-08-19
03:49:03.000000000 -0400
+++ linux-2.6.18-rc4/drivers/ide/ide.c 2006-08-20 19:12:38.000000000
-0400
@@ -1232,6 +1232,7 @@
struct request rq;
struct request_pm_state rqpm;
ide_task_t args;
+ int ide_cmd;
memset(&rq, 0, sizeof(rq));
memset(&rqpm, 0, sizeof(rqpm));
@@ -1242,7 +1243,15 @@
rqpm.pm_step = ide_pm_state_start_resume;
rqpm.pm_state = PM_EVENT_ON;
- return ide_do_drive_cmd(drive, &rq, ide_head_wait);
+ ide_cmd = ide_do_drive_cmd(drive, &rq, ide_head_wait);
+
+ /* check to see if this is a hard drive
+ * if it is then checkhpa needs to be
+ * disabled */
+ if(drive->media == ide_disk && idedisk_supports_hpa(drive->id))
+ init_idedisk_capacity(drive);
+
+ return ide_cmd;
}
